Product details

Two-channel CMOS op-amp for signal conditioning

The OPA2363IDGST: Each channel draws 1.1 mA supply current, keeping the total quiescent draw at 2.2 mA for the pair — a fit for battery-powered or thermally constrained boards.

Input bias and temperature range for sensor front-ends

Input bias current is 1 pA typical — low enough that a 10 MΩ source resistor contributes only 10 µV of offset error, making the OPA2363IDGST usable for photodiode amplifiers, pH probes, and other high-impedance transducers. The operating temperature range spans -40 °C to 125 °C, covering industrial enclosures, engine-bay electronics, and outdoor telecom cabinets without grade sorting.
